(Mostly South Austin Recs) Play Street Museum is great, I think parties include 20 kids plus an additional fee for extra kids. My Gym does great parties that have some activities led by their staff. We went to a birthday party at Metz Splash pad in East Austin, it wasn’t super crowded, they had picnic tables for breakfast tacos and the cupcakes. We also like Dick Nichols Park where you can reserve picnic tables and they have a water feature that is simple and perfect for just 3 year olds, also there volleyball courts serve as a massive sand box. Pease Park is also fun and has the option to reserve picnic tables plus they usually have a snow cone cart that does a bubble party and they have a splash pad too.

Lost creek park is shaded, has a bathroom and a pavilion to rent out. Bee Cave park has the same. Rollingwood park is also shaded but unsure on the bathroom situation.
